#e7fe9e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e7fe9e is composed of 90.6% red, 99.6%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.8%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 74.4 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 80.8%. #e7fe9e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cffd3d. Closest websafe color is: #ffff99.

#e7fe9e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e7fe9e has RGB values of R:231, G:254,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0, Y:0.38, K:0. Its decimal value is 15203998.
